Methylacidimicrobium cyclopophantes 3B and Methylacidimicrobium tartarophylax 4AC are Gram-negative rod-shaped mesophilic methanotrophs isolated from soil samples with low pH at the Solfatara Crater, near Naples, Italy. The genomes of these extremophilic verrucomicrobia were sequenced using Illumina technology, and both species possess one pmoCAB operon and two xoxF genes.
